The Evolution of Infantry Warfare

The evolution of infantry warfare has undergone significant transformations from its inception in classical times to the modern battlefield. Initially characterized by linear formations and hand-to-hand combat, infantry strategies evolved with technological advancements and changing warfare dynamics. The introduction of gunpowder marked a pivotal transition, enabling soldiers to engage enemies at greater distances, effectively reshaping battlefield tactics.

As firearms and artillery developed, infantry units became essential in combined arms operations, coordinating with cavalry and artillery to optimize their effectiveness. The 20th century brought further innovations, including mechanization and the use of armored vehicles, which allowed infantry to maneuver effectively under fire. These advancements necessitated adaptations in tactics and strategy, highlighting the importance of flexibility in infantry roles.

In recent decades, the evolution of infantry warfare has been shaped by technological integration and an emphasis on information warfare. The incorporation of advanced communication systems, drones, and precision-guided munitions has transformed how infantry units engage and operate in diverse environments. This ongoing change indicates that the future of infantry warfare will continue to adapt to the challenges posed by emerging technologies and evolving combat scenarios.

Innovations in Infantry Gear and Equipment

Innovations in infantry gear and equipment have significantly transformed battlefield dynamics. Today, advanced materials and technology enhance the operational effectiveness of infantry units, improving both mobility and protection. Lightweight ballistic vests and advanced helmets provide soldiers with superior protection without compromising agility.

The incorporation of smart textiles into uniforms facilitates enhanced performance through climate regulation and health monitoring systems. Such innovations contribute to the soldiers’ endurance and overall effectiveness in diverse environments. Additionally, modular equipment allows for quick adjustments to meet mission-specific requirements, enhancing adaptability in ever-changing combat scenarios.

Furthermore, the integration of communication systems into infantry gear ensures real-time information sharing among soldiers on the ground. Enhanced communication capabilities enable better coordination during operations, supporting the evolution of infantry warfare. As these innovations continue to unfold, they represent a critical aspect of preparing infantry forces for future challenges.
